House Over House Over House Busts Two
Level 22
: 20,000/40,000, 40,000 ante
The hand was relayed by the table. Barnabas Nagy open-jammed for 400,000 from the button before Chen Keren moved all-in for 900,000 from the small blind. Leo Worthington-Leese called off his final 800,000 from the big blind.

Each player caught something on the flop, But Wothington-Leese had the best of it with a set of eights. That changed on the turn to put Nagy on the brink of a triple up with queens full of eights.
It was then Keren's turn to make a full house following the river and he scooped the pot while sending two of his opponents to the rail in spectacular fashion.
